Program Overview

Bachelor of Logistics Management ( Turkish ), Beykent University

The Bachelor of Logistics Management program focuses on the planning, implementation, and control of logistics operations in the supply chain. It aims to equip students with the skills needed to manage inventory, transportation, and warehousing, ensuring efficient and cost-effective logistics solutions.

Curriculum

The curriculum includes courses such as Supply Chain Management
Transportation Logistics
Inventory Control
Warehouse Management
and Operations Management.
